## Ceremony Checklist — Item 4: Brindlebook Import Keys

As the new contractor, your part is simple: watch the key generation for the Brindlebook catalogue import run on the offline workstation, confirm the displayed fingerprint matches the one read aloud by the ceremony lead, and initial the margin of the printed record. Once the fingerprint is confirmed, write down the recovery passphrase exactly as it appears below.

strongbox words: sorir-belvan-rusix-ulays-ralmir-praix-eliir-tamax-praael-druael-julir-tamius-jorir

# Catalogue import for the Brindlewood Library system. Batches MARC-ish
# records from the Shelfwright feed into our local index. Do not raise
# batch size without checking memory on the ingest pods; Shelfwright
# throttles aggressively past 500 rps. Retries are idempotent by record
# hash. The tuning constants below reflect the last load test:

tuning constants:
TIERS = {
    "sorion": 670,
    "istax": 547,
}

Subject: Handover — thumbnail queue release

Hi, taking over on-call tonight? The Pictogrid thumbnail generation queue is mid-rollout: workers on v5.2 are draining the old queue while v5.3 consumers pick up new jobs. Watch the backlog gauge; if it climbs past 10k, pause the migration script. Any re-deploy of the consumer image must be signed, so you'll need the current deploy key, included below.

rollout seal: bky4_x7Gc